  10. We didn't used to have one but then a raid failed because of a monster entering the jelly during the holding phase and killing the tank team. The holders died and Hami spawned his mitos, ending the raid. Some raids since then have had a GM team, some have not. There's no doubt that it can be useful to have a GM team, however it's the one element whose presence isn't required in terms of actually getting a raid off the ground on the night.
  11. [ QUOTE ]
    What do you suggest taking aid other or stimulant so that I can get aid self?

    [/ QUOTE ]

    Stimulant. It doesn't need any extra slotting to be useful and it's something you can apply before a fight and not need to worry about whereas if you take Aid Other you might feel compelled to use it mid-battle and end up dragging all your aggroed mobs down on top of your hurt team mate (against foes that use AoE's a lot this would be bad).
  12. I've an ill/FF that I've soloed up to 32 so far. I'm sure other secondaries would have it easier some or even most of the time (my ill/kin soloed easier because of his heal and buffs/debuffs) but FF does have its uses in a solo situation. Force bolt is a great way of keeping that third minion out of melee while you're holding and deceiving his friends. PFF is a handy panic button to have and has saved my guy's life a few times. Dispersion bubble was a godsend against the Tsoo with their disorienting minions and against other mezzers too. Deflection and insulation shield become useful once you get to 32 and Phantasm. The set has some holes like no protection against sleep and no self heal but it's easy enough to work around those through inspiration use and use of PFF when things get really bad. All in all it's a very soloable build in my opinion. However, if asked to choose between soloing my ill/ff or my ill/kin to 50 from lvl 1 again I would pick my ill/kin without hesitation - I just had more fun with the /kin powers than I do with the /ff powers (and this is coming from someone who loves playing his team-only FF defender).
